Is Your Business Concept Worth Proper Startup Investment?

How to understand that your app idea will stand startup investment competition?

Giving your idea an objective assessment stands among crucial factors while pitching app project to potential investors. 

There are four basic criteria to check if your venture is ready to be pitched:

1. The app solves an urgent problem

The simplest strategy to find investors for startup and get funding implies solving the issue that troubles customers. However, despite outer simplicity, it may occur a real challenge to develop an innovative concept meeting current app investors demand. 

2. The app optimizes already existing solution

Providing a different perspective on existing solutions promises funding for app startup as well. It usually includes app optimization or certain improvements, concerning outdated functionality upgrades, new features implementation, or design updates that make app more user-friendly or accessible for inclusive customer groups.

3. The app ensures profit

A win-win option for startups looking for investment is promising guaranteed profit. If your app is about paying off in the nearest future and bring additional benefits, any capitalist will gladly invest money into it. All you need is to prove its market success with well-designed business plan.

4. The app proves its productivity in the long run

Showcasing long-lasting results represents one more opportunity popular among startups looking for investors. Many companies bet on building loyal client base, acquiring firm market position, and creating positive venture’s image, thus they tend to invest in startup apps guaranteeing output relevant in the long run.

How to Effectively Pitch Your Business Idea to Investors and Get Funding?

Useful tips on productive concept pitching to get funding for app startup.1. Introduce yourself

Company’s name represents a label startup investors must know. Create a recognizable image of your business with successful products you have already rolled out, brave ideas, strong efforts and enthusiasm you show while pitching the application.

2. Meet the team!

Team composition is of no less importance: make emphasis on experts involved into current venture, their diverse experiences, contribution into idea processing, successful projects, etc. Knowing personalities helps in successful establishing developer – investor relations.

3. Define the problem & offer unique solution

Stressing the problem you intend to solve stands among key points while app pitching. Clearly stated problem with customer pain points discussed highlights relevance of app solution you intend to get funded.

While exposing the problem analyze solutions that have already been developed. Explain key differences between your app idea and existing examples emphasizing innovations you offer. Elaborate a detailed plan that will give potential investors a vision of how you will implement concept into life.

4. Hit the big time!

Choose the right time for start. While pitching app venture, tell investors for app development why now is the optimal time to fund your app. Emphasize problem’s urgency and market needs to sound convincing enough.

5. Estimate app market potential & define your place within the system

Profound market research is a must-have stage for startups looking for investment. Evaluate the size and development level of market segment you want enter, define target audience, and build grows chart illustrating app’s success after entering the niche.

Knowing own competitive chances is crucial while market analysis. It allows highlight strengths while presenting app project to investors, as well as explore and correct possible weak point long before rolling out final application version.

6. Prepare a convincing business plan

Elaborated business plan is a base of any project success. To be convincing enough it must answer one key question: how can we make money out of good concept? Make a path from idea to profit visible to get funding for app startup.

Thus, any successful business plan includes marketing strategy and sales plans directed at achieving goals in shortest period possible. Besides, figures always matter, so paying attention to prices also constitutes an important part of funding estimate. 

7. Build a realistic budget

Presenting a budget one must always take into consideration both sides of money issue. First, conduct a profound analysis of capital already involved into project to calculate the investments ‘from outside’. While pitching budget to investors, emphasize minimum funding an app needs to be launched, and possible profit a capitalist gets funding your app. 

Second, define key milestones in fund distribution and take care of other funding opportunities. E.g., crowdfunding may become an additional funding source to promote initial app concept and make it visible for developed companies or investors for app development, while frameworks, services, or toolkits free from charges (e.g. Bootstrap, Xamarin, react native, etc.) reduce development process expenses at initial stages. Besides, think over equity fund distribution: decide on the part preserved by company itself and the part sold to startup investors.

While budget planning, startups looking for investors should not forget about possible funding risks as well.

8. Take care of copyright issues

Legal issues also play an important part while product funding pitching. Startup investors should be warned about possible risks connected with copyright details and intellectual property used in product development process. This information ensures investor’s legal status and is crucial in cases of emergency.

Don’t Go Without a Prototype

Presenting striking prototype features increases your chances to attract investors for app development.

Having a working application mockup is always a benefit while your business presentation. Direct interaction with the product in most cases has a convincing impact on startup investors, as capitalists usually fund tangible results. 

Prototype app may not be a round solution with perfect optimization and all functional scope implemented, though it must demonstrate the features you bet on. Developing app prototype, one should emphasize innovative solutions that will distinguish the app from other ideas. Selected features must show application at its best and, if possible, produce a wow-effect, ensuring funding through appealing first-hand experience. 

In case the prototype app is not ready yet, do not forget about visual aids like design concepts, drafts, or schemes concerning future app.
